Output 4ed68f25aef290e83661ebaae07a96e9ddcecafcdec3b4971ec4e32ec0bbadd9:21

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 d84ab29d36daa8a49cd97f2f5d3d0fc3e6d6022a
address
tb1qmp9t98fkm252f8xe0uh460g0c0ndvq32crpwmx
transaction
4ed68f25aef290e83661ebaae07a96e9ddcecafcdec3b4971ec4e32ec0bbadd9
confirmations
6766
spent
true